As Microsoft's mobile market share dwindled, maintaining the app became less commercially viable. While the Android and iOS versions received rapid feature updates like voice calling, video calling, and end-to-end encryption, the Windows Phone XAP version lagged behind due to OS architecture limitations. A was the standard installation package format used for apps on Windows Phone 7, 8, and 8.1 . WhatsApp was one of the most popular apps on the platform, providing a seamless messaging experience for Lumia and other Windows-based mobile devices.
